We have been home for several weeks now and I have had some time to look back on what I learned during our travels. Here are some of the things I learned during those wonderful 3 weeks:

1. God is incredibly creative. We saw so many different kinds of beauty during our travels, and not one bit of it strained God in any way to create. And to think this is what it looks like after we have come along and messed it up!
2. My sweet husband loves to talk to everyone he sees in other countries too, and doesn't let language barriers of any kind stop him!
3. Packing light is worth it when you are going to be changing hotels every few days, and really is doable even for the longer trips!
4. The exception to #3 is when it is raining. We decided you really just can't have enough clothes with you when they are constantly getting wet.
5. Having friends and family who will take care of your house and your beloved pets while you are away is a huge blessing!
6. Taking extra memory cards was a good idea. We are still sorting through the 6,000+ pictures from our trip. :-O
7. Planning ahead is so worth the time. Overall, our trip went really smoothly. I can't imagine if we had tried to figure everything out when we got there! Having some kind of plan, and at least knowing where you are going to stay, frees up so much time for you to explore the place you have worked so hard to get to.
8. Just because everywhere you are visiting is surrounded by beautiful bodies of water does not mean they are swimming-friendly. Justin was pretty bummed about this one.
9.  I have an incredibly sweet and very fun husband. He is a great travel companion!
10. Coming home from a vacation you have dreamed about for years is hard. But getting to see all of your friends and family, sleeping in your own bed, and clean clothes sure make it easier!
